C elebrated "wild ponies," actually stunted feral horses, ran loose over much of the Outer Banks until the late 1930s, when the General Assembly abolished free range north of Hatteras Inlet.Five herds of these "Banker" ponies survived by the early 2000s. One genetic factor, the blood variant Q-ac, is believed to be contributed by the Spanish horses of 400 years ago. Shackleford Banks, the southern-most barrier island in Cape Lookout National Seashore, is home to more than 100 wild horses.
